UPDATE: June 10, 2026: Aluminum producer Novelis has restarted its hot mill operations in Oswego, New York, after two fires damaged the facility last year.
“We are deeply grateful for the flexibility and partnerships our customers have shown, as well as the extraordinary efforts of our employees, suppliers and industry peers who came together to support continuity of supply,” Steve Fisher, Novelis president and CEO, said in a statement Wednesday.
The company, a major supplier to Ford and other automakers, said it will work closely with customers to ramp up supply now that the facility is back online. During the outage, Novelis relied on a global network of hot mills and finishing operations to meet domestic demand.
